Helping Toddlers Cope with the Loss of a Dog, With Gentle Affirmations and Comforting Joy.

Losing a beloved dog can be confusing and heartbreaking for a toddler. Many parents and caregivers struggle to explain pet death in a way that feels safe, age-appropriate, and emotionally supportive.

That's where I Remember the Fun: Bye Bye Doggy! comes in, offering a tender, affirmation-themed toddler book about a dog's death, thoughtfully designed for children ages 2-4.

With soothing language and playful rhythm, this picture book helps young children process grief by focusing on the joyful memories they shared with their furry friend. Each page encourages toddlers to talk, laugh, remember, and feel love even after saying goodbye.

Why Parents, Teachers, and Guardians Will Love This Book:

Toddler-Friendly Language: Simple phrases like "I remember the fun!" and "I hug my blankie" gently validate feelings of loss and sadness. Positive Memory Focus: Instead of overwhelming a toddler with big concepts, this book celebrates familiar experiences, like fetch, belly rubs, and tail wags, helping children feel safe and seen. Affirmation Power: Repeating lines like "I still feel the love" and "I remember the fun" builds emotional resilience and connection. Interactive Prompts: Toddlers are invited to say their dog's name, look at pictures, and draw memories, turning grief into expression.

Whether you're navigating the first loss of a pet or supporting a preschooler through difficult emotions, this sweet and supportive pet loss book for toddlers will be a comforting companion for years to come.
